> Try this one:
> 
> create or replace PROCEDURE send2 
> (sender IN VARCHAR2, 
> recipient IN VARCHAR2, 
> subj IN VARCHAR2,
> body IN VARCHAR2) 
> crlf VARCHAR2(2):= CHR( 13 ) || CHR( 10 );
> mesg VARCHAR2(4000);
> mail_conn UTL_SMTP.CONNECTION;
> cc_recipient VARCHAR2(50) default '[EMAIL PROTECTED]';
> bcc_recipient VARCHAR2(50) default '[EMAIL PROTECTED]'; 
> BEGIN 
> 
> mail_conn:= utl_smtp.open_connection('mailhost', 25); 
> utl_smtp.helo(mail_conn, 'mailhost'); 
> utl_smtp.mail(mail_conn, sender); 
> utl_smtp.rcpt(mail_conn, recipient); 
> utl_smtp.rcpt(mail_conn, cc_recipient); 
> utl_smtp.rcpt(mail_conn, bcc_recipient); 
> mesg:= 'Date: ' || TO_CHAR( SYSDATE, 'dd Mon yy hh24:mi:ss' ) || crlf ||
> 'From: ' || sender || crlf ||
> 'To: ' || recipient || crlf ||
> 'Cc: ' || cc_recipient || crlf ||
> 'Bcc: ' || bcc_recipient || crlf ||
> 'Subject: ' || subj || crlf;
> mesg:= mesg || '' || crlf || body; 
> utl_smtp.data(mail_conn, mesg); 
> utl_smtp.quit(mail_conn); 
> EXCEPTION 
> WHEN OTHERS THEN 
> dbms_output.put_line(sqlerrm); 
> END; 
> /

> Hi Gurus,
> 
> I am trying to used UTL_SMTP to send an e-mail form my oracle machine. I
> tried the sample code from oracle documentation.
> 
> PROCEDURE send_mail (sender    IN VARCHAR2,
>                                        recipient IN VARCHAR2,
>                                        message   IN VARCHAR2)
> as
>     mailhost    VARCHAR2(30) := 'mail.somewhere.com';
>     mail_conn  utl_smtp.connection;
> 
> BEGIN
>     mail_conn := utl_smtp.open_connection(mailhost, 25);
>     utl_smtp.helo(mail_conn, mailhost);
>     utl_smtp.mail(mail_conn, sender);
>     utl_smtp.rcpt(mail_conn, recipient);
>     utl_smtp.data(mail_conn, message);
>     utl_smtp.quit(mail_conn);
> EXCEPTION
>     WHEN OTHERS THEN
>         dbms_output.put_line('error');
>         -- Handle the error
> END;
> 
> and i call the procedure from sqlplus
> 
> 
> begin
> send_mail('[EMAIL PROTECTED]','[EMAIL PROTECTED]','test from oracle');
> end;
> 
> 
> and i receive the e-mail like this
> 
> 
> Return-Path: <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> 
> Delivered-To: [EMAIL PROTECTED]
> Received: (qmail 3139 invoked from network); 4 Jul 2001 09:58:00 -0000 
> Received: from oracle.somewhere.com (HELO mail.somewhere.com)
> (192.169.0.25)
> 
> by mail.somewhere.com with SMTP; 4 Jul 2001 09:58:01 -0000 
> X-AntiVirus: scanned for viruses by AMaViS 0.2.1 (http://amavis.org/) 
> 
> test form oracle
> 
> 
> the problem is i lost the sender ( it sould be [EMAIL PROTECTED]) and
> the
> title (i don't know where i must put the title).
